After a lower limb injury, keeping the area fixed is key to healing. Immobilization of fractures and/or dislocations of the leg, ankle, and foot consists of securing the region with a cast, splint, or similar device.
What is it for? It helps the bones heal in a good position, reduces pain, and protects the joint during recovery.
What does it include? After assessing the injury, the appropriate support is applied and instructions on support and follow-up are given.
Who performs it? It is performed by an orthopedist, with the involvement of a general practitioner or nursing staff. In cases of severe pain or deformity after a blow, it's best to seek care as soon as possible.
